My First Apartment
初めての一人暮らし
英語ストーリー
Moving into my first apartment was exciting! I carefully unpacked my boxes, placing my favorite books on the shelf and arranging my photos on the desk. The small space felt cozy and uniquely mine. I spent the afternoon organizing my kitchen, placing my new dishes and utensils in their designated spots. Everything felt fresh and new.
That evening, I cooked my first solo dinner – pasta with tomato sauce. It wasn't fancy, but it tasted amazing! The quiet solitude felt peaceful, a stark contrast to the bustling family home I'd left behind. I realized that this was my chance to truly discover who I am, independently and freely.
Later that night, while listening to music, I felt a pang of loneliness. It was a new feeling, but I knew I could handle it. I had my books, my music, and most importantly, myself. I was ready for this new chapter.
The next morning, I woke up early, excited for the day ahead. It was the start of a new adventure, full of possibilities and challenges. I was finally living on my own, and I couldn't be happier.
